WebMay 15, 2024 · Taxation in Guernsey is the responsibility of the Director of the Revenue Service in Guernsey and the principal legislation is contained in the Income Tax (Guernsey) Law, 1975 as extensively amended since 1975. Guernsey does not levy any form of capital gains tax, inheritance tax or value added tax. No stamp or document duty, or transfer tax ... WebApr 14, 2024 · MINISTRY OF LAW AND JUSTICE (Legislative Department) New Delhi, the 12th April, 2024 CORRIGENDA THE FINANCE ACT, 2024 No. 8 OF 2024 In the Finance Act, … WebJan 4, 2024 · On 13 December 2013, Guernsey signed an IGA regarding the implementation of Foreign Account Tax Compliance Act (FATCA). The IGA has been ratified by Guernsey's Parliament and is embodied in The Income Tax (Approved International Agreements) (Implementation) (United Kingdom and United States of America) Regulations 2014.

WebJan 4, 2024 · Tax is payable at the rate of 20% on net income after allowances (see the Deductions section for a description of allowances). It is possible for a Guernsey resident individual to elect for a cap on their income tax liability. Elections can be made for a liability cap of GBP 150,000 to apply for an individual or couple on non-Guernsey-source ...
